The Hyderabad trade, honestly

Hyderabad’s pharmacy trade sits downstream of its own industry: bulk-drug and formulation plants at Jeedimetla and Pashamylaram, research campuses in Genome Valley, and the wholesale medicine rows around Koti supplying chemists across Telangana. Hospital pharmacies attached to the corporate chains compete directly with the neighbourhood counter, and the Telangana Drugs Control Administration is an active inspector of Schedule H1 registers and purchase records. A chemist here gains most from clean batch-and-expiry stock, FEFO issue at the counter, and GST purchase books that reconcile against stockist invoices from an unusually short supply chain.

How do batch and expiry work at the counter?

Billing picks the earliest-expiry batch first (FEFO) automatically, every strip carries its batch, expiry and MRP, and the Expiry Radar ranks stock at risk in 30/60/90-day windows by value. Expiry Rescue then recommends the recovery action per batch — return to supplier, push, clear or dispose — before the window closes.

How does GST work for a Telangana pharmacy?

Medicine GST rates are scheduled nationally, retail billing is MRP-inclusive with the tax backed out, and your GSTR-1/3B build from posted double-entry books rather than a sales export. Moving stock within Telangana needs an e-way bill above the state-notified threshold — check the current notification; LekhaPro generates the JSON from the invoice either way.
